At a time in my life when I was evaluating where I was and where I was going, I made a prayer and a promise to God I would search His word for myself, with His help and study all doctrines I had been taught. I started on the Oneness of God, got the resolved, then Jesus name baptism, resolved that as well. I then took an interest I the end times and, for a time, became a resolute proponent of pre-trib teachings, but Matt 24 was not making sense. I kept studying and then it seemed post-trib fit better, but still some loose ends and was really difficult to present it honestly, as I was trying to be honest and not merely trying to confirm or prove what I already thought I believed as I sincerely wanted what was truth, not necessarily what was popular.
Larry T. Smith came out with some teachings that I thought should be easily refutable, but the more I looked at what he was presenting, it filled in the loose ends I had. The more I studied, the more it became clear to me that Matt 24 in particular was directed to that generation that saw the temple destroyed. It occurred in AD70. I now don't have to evade or breeze over the scriptures that didn't fit pre-mid or post trib teachings.
